Frequently Asked Questions about Indianapolis
How much are Studio apartments in Indianapolis?
There are currently 526 Studio Apartments in Indianapolis with rent ranges from $495 to $5,271 with an average price of $1,187.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Indianapolis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Indianapolis ranges from $497 to $4,333 with an average monthly rent of $1,391.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Indianapolis c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Indianapolis range from $545 to $5,655.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,649.
How expensive are Indianapolis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 504 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Indianapolis on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$626 to $8,304 - averaging $2,036 for the location.
